Mühletor is a captivating historical landmark in Feldkirch, Austria, offering visitors a glimpse into the region's rich past. This ancient gate, surrounded by picturesque landscapes, is a must-see for anyone exploring the town.

Car
If you're driving from the center of Bregenzerwald, head southeast on Bregenzerstraße/B200. Continue for approximately 20 kilometers until you reach the intersection with L190 (Feldkircherstraße). Turn right onto L190 and follow the signs for Feldkirch. After about 10 kilometers, take the exit toward Feldkirch-Zentrum. Merge onto Mühletorpl. You will find Mühletor at Mühletorpl. 20, 6800 Feldkirch. Parking may be available nearby, but check local signs for any fees.
Public Transportation
To reach Mühletor via public transport, start by taking a bus from your location in Bregenzerwald to Feldkirch. Check the local bus schedules; the most common route is to take bus line 35 towards Feldkirch. The journey takes approximately 30-40 minutes. Once you arrive at the Feldkirch bus station, exit and walk towards Mühletorpl., which is around a 15-minute walk. Simply follow Mühletorstraße until you reach Mühletorpl. 20. Note that public transport tickets may cost around €3-5 depending on your starting point.
